KEMP SIGNS AMENDED FY ’21 BUDGET

Governor Brian Kemp signed the amended Fiscal Year ’21 budget for Georgia at the State Capitol down in Atlanta on Monday afternoon. Among highlights – one-time $1,000 bonuses for state employees that make less than $80,000 a year.

Kemp said that, “By restoring education funding, making key investments in expanding internet access, prioritizing public health, giving 57,000 state employees a well-deserved bonus, and spurring economic development in every corner of our state, this budget ensures Georgia will continue being the best state to live, work, and raise a family.”
